GLEESON CJ: This appeal was heard in Canberra on 4 February 2000 by a Court constituted by Justices Gaudron, Gummow, Kirby, Callinan and myself. On 7 March 2000 the Court ordered that the appeal be allowed and stated that reasons for the order would be given at a later date. I publish the joint reasons of Justices Gaudron, Gummow, Callinan and myself.
KIRBY J: I now publish my reasons for coming to a different view.
